The introduction of double bonds between carbon atoms in the fatty acid chain causes kinks and makes the chain unsaturated. This process is catalyzed by enzymes called desaturases, which introduce the double bonds by removing hydrogen atoms. The presence of these double bonds significantly affects the physical properties of the fatty acids.

Unsaturated fats have double bonds in their carbon chain, which creates a kink in the structure. This kink prevents the molecules from tightly packing together, keeping them in a more fluid state at room temperature compared to saturated fats that have no double bonds.
